Which of the following is not normally considered an element of culture?a. values and belief systems
b. religious practices
c. gender roles in society
d. race or skin color

Answers

Answer 1
Answer:

Answer:

The correct answer to the question: Which of the following is not normally considered an element of culture?, would be: D: Race or skin color.

Explanation:

Elements of culture is a term used to define all those characteristics that are not born, or inherited, through genetics, but are created through contact with a cultural system. Gender roles, and belief and value systems, as well as religion, are all characteristics that are learned within a culture, and are not born with a person. However, race and skin color are completely dependent on genetics, heredity, and also on environmental exposure to elements. They are not acquired through learning, or exposure to a system of beliefs.

If the MPC is 5/6 then the multiplier is a. 6, so a $200 increase in government spending increases aggregate demand by $1200.
b. 5, so a $200 increase in government spending increases aggregate supply by $1000.
c. 6/5, so a $200 increase in government spending increases aggregate demand by $240.
d. 6/5, so a $200 increase in government spending increases aggregate supply by $1200. 5 points

Answers

Answer: a. 6, so a $200 increase in government spending increases aggregate demand by $1200.

Explanation:

The multiplier, k is defined as the total effect of an injection on the economy. For example if the government decides to inject $200 through into the economy by carrying out new road constructions, the total amount this creates is more than $200.

The contractors who are assigned the projects spend some of the money on delivering the project and the remaining on investment, savings or consumption. This is also true for the employees of the company.

The formula to calculate the multiplier, k = (1)/(1-MPC)

Therefore, k = (1)/(1-5/6)

k = 6

The total injection in the economy = 6 x $200 = $1,200
